I finished all the Twilight series books. The last two books did not change my initial opinion at all. As I posted last week about the first two, I do see why they might appeal to readers, and many of my friends love them, but I cannot suspend disbelief to enter the author's world.

You see, when I was 18, the same age as Bella in the last three books, I was stalked. It was a horrible, scary time and some of Edward's behavior is so similar it's frightening. Imagine no matter where you go, day or night, the same person is always there watching you, sometimes close, sometimes far, but always there. You get your mail one day, and there's a letter. He knows way more about you than he should, and you realize even when you can't see him he's with you. He also talks about the future, your future with him. This person wants to be with you, only you, forever.

Though Twilight fans have rolled their eyes or sighed saying I just don't get it or that I'm taking the books way too seriously, I see nothing loving or protecting in Edward's behavior. Their relationship is not romantic, it's abusive. He's a sociapath and even the actor who plays him in the movie says Edward is creepy. Enough said.
